MEGANE RENAULTSPORT: 250HP OF PURE PLEASURE
As the latest in a long line of Renault
performance models, New Mégane Renaultsport 250
stands out through its exhilarating performance
and handling. The fusion of its extra 25hp with
unmistakable sporting coupé credentials and
choice of two chassis settings (sport and Cup,
the latter with a limited slip differential) is
clear evidence that New Mégane Renaultsport has
been honed to delight enthusiasts.
Coming after Mégane F1 Team R26 and Mégane
R26.R, New Mégane Renaultsport 250 profits fully
from Renault Sport Technologies' extensive
experience when it comes to manufacturing
performance models.
Powerful
New Mégane Renaultsport 250 is powered by a
new-generation two-litre 16-valve turbocharged
petrol engine which boasts maximum power of
250hp
at 5,500rpm and peak torque of
340Nm from 3,000rpm. The sum of the different
improvements made to this engine has produced a
gain of 20hp and 40Nm over Mégane R26.R which
itself emerged as the yardstick in the world of
performance hatches. The Renaultsport engine's
twin-scroll turbo is exceptionally responsive,
particularly at lows revs, with 80 per cent of
maximum torque available from 1,900rpm. Its wide
power band makes it a genuine joy to drive in
everyday use, and the pleasure remains
undiminished all the way up to the rev-limiter
whenever it is pushed a little harder. The
engine of New Mégane Renaultsport 250 transmits
its power through a six-speed manual gearbox.
Work has also gone into the acoustics of the
Renaultsport engine to produce a tell-tale
sporty note audible inside the cabin under
acceleration.
Efficient
New Mégane Renaultsport 250 has inherited the
same suspension arrangement as the current
version. Thanks to an independent steering axis
layout at the front, the suspension and steering
functions have been separated to ensure a
particularly high standard of handling allied
with great traction.
Like the Renaultsport versions of the Clio and
Twingo ranges, New Mégane Renaultsport is
available with a choice of two chassis: the
standard sport chassis or the Cup chassis, which
comes with a limited slip differential for even
greater traction.
The electric power steering features specific
calibration and benefits from the latest
improvements seen on New Mégane aimed at
achieving greater precision and even more
feedback from the road.
New Mégane Renaultsport 250 is equipped with ESP
which is fully disconnectable in order to enable
owners to enjoy their car's full potential on a
circuit.
Provocative
New Mégane Renaultsport 250 benefits from
undeniably sporty looks. The front bumper
incorporates the LED daytime running lights, as
well as the splitter which recalls the low-slung
nose of the R28 Formula 1 car. The dynamic looks
are further emphasised by extended wheel arches
and sills, 18-inch alloy wheels, central exhaust
tailpipe and rear diffuser.
The interior design, too, recalls the world of
motor sport, from the extra lateral support for
the seats, to the analogue rev-counter with
visual and audible gearshift indicator, the
aluminium pedals and the Renaultsport steering
wheel complete with thumb grips. The
Renaultsport signature is also visible inside
the car: on the headrests, rev-counter and
dashboard.
Renault Sport Technologies has combined its
experience of motor sport with its longstanding
production expertise to develop a comprehensive
range of sporting cars. The hallmarks of
Renaultsport models are their pedigree engines
and efficient chassis which together deliver an
undeniably high level of sports performance, as
testified by the reputation forged by Mégane F1
Team R26 and Mégane R26.R which were voted
'Sporting Car of the Year' in France in 2007 and
2008 respectively.
New Mégane Renaultsport 250 goes on sale in the
UK later this year.
